State Rep. Mike Hill is launching his first television ad this week, emphasizing his military background. Hill, a Pensacola Beach insurance agent, is facing state Rep. Doug Broxson of Gulf Breeze in the Aug. 30 Republican primary for Senate District 1, which includes all of Escambia and Santa Rosa counties and a portion of Okaloosa. […]
